Muhammad Ali Kentucky Humanitarian Awardee Announced

Dr. Andrew Moore, II, of Lexington, Kentucky to Receive Kentucky Humanitarian Award at Third Annual Muhammad Ali Humanitarian Awards This September

Moore is Honored for Founding ‘Surgery On Sunday’

LOUISVILLE, Kentucky (July 3, 2015) — Dr. Andrew Moore, II, a Lexington-based plastic surgeon, will be presented the 2015 Kentucky Humanitarian Award at the Third Annual Muhammad Ali Humanitarian Awards taking place on Saturday, September 19th at the Marriott Louisville Downtown. Specifically, Dr. Moore was chosen for this award for founding Surgery on Sunday, a program that he and an army of almost 450 volunteers commit themselves to on the third Sunday of each month at the Lexington Surgery Center, for individuals across the Commonwealth of Kentucky who cannot afford much needed medical services. Dr. Moore and his team of physicians, anesthesiologists, nurses, and administrative personnel have donated nearly 90,000 hours of service since the organization was founded in 2005, the same year the Ali Center opened.

The Muhammad Ali Humanitarian Awards, presented by the YUM! Brands Foundation, is a charitable event of celebration and recognition which honors individuals around the world who have made significant contributions toward the attainment of peace, social justice, or other positive actions pertaining to human or social capital. In addition to the awards for “seasoned” humanitarians, six young people, 30 years and younger, are also honored with distinctions that correlate with Muhammad’s Six Core Principles: Confidence, Conviction, Dedication, Giving, Respect, and Spirituality.

ABOUT THE MUHAMMAD ALI CENTER

The Muhammad Ali Center, a 501(c)3 corporation, was co-founded by Muhammad Ali and his wife Lonnie in their hometown of Louisville, Kentucky. The international cultural center promotes the six core principles of Muhammad Ali (Confidence, Conviction, Dedication, Giving, Respect, and Spirituality) in ways that inspire personal and global greatness and provides programming and events around the focus areas of education, gender equity, and global citizenship. Its newest initiative, Generation Ali, fosters a new generation of leaders to contribute positively to their communities and to change the world for the better.
